软件测试怎么测试bug,软件测试怎么测试一支笔

软件测试怎么测试bug目录

软件测试怎么测试bug

软件测试怎么测试一支笔

软件测试怎么测试的

软件测试怎么测试一个杯子

软件测试怎么测试bug

如何有效测试软件中的 Bug。

什么是 Bug?。

Bug软件中的缺陷或错误,它会导致程序出现意外的行为或结果。

如何测试 Bug?。

以下步骤可帮助您有效地测试 Bug:。

1. 验证已报告的 Bug。

检查 Bug 报告以准确了解 Bug 的预期行为。重新创建 Bug 以确认它仍然存在。

2. 测试边界条件。

测试功能的边界条件,例如输入值、范围和数据类型。边界条件经常是 Bug 的潜在来源。

3. 隔离 Bug。

使用二分查找法或模块化测试来隔离造成 Bug 的代码部分。这样可以提高调试效率。

4. 探索相关代码。

检查 Bug 周围的代码,包括与有缺陷功能交互的任何其他模块或函数。

5. 识别 Bug 的根源。

使用调试工具(例如日志记录、断点或堆栈跟踪)来确定导致 Bug 的根本原因。

6. 编写修复程序。

根据 Bug 的根源,编写修复程序来解决该问题。确保修复程序不会引入新的 Bug。

7. 反复测试。

对修复后的代码进行回归测试以确保 Bug 已解决,并且没有引入新的 Bug。

提示:。

- 使用测试用例来覆盖各种场景。

- 考虑使用自动化测试工具来提高效率和覆盖率。

- 与开发人员合作以获取有关 Bug 的背景信息。

- 记录发现和解决的 Bug,以供将来参考。

- 定期进行代码审查以主动发现 Bug。

软件测试怎么测试一支笔

如何通过软件测试评判一支笔

在软件测试领域,测试一切事物都是可能的,即使是一支简单的笔。通过对一支笔进行彻底的软件测试,你可以评估其功能、质量和用户体验。

功能测试

书写动作:验证笔是否能够流畅、均匀地书写。

颜色准确性:检查笔芯的颜色与墨水颜色是否一致。

墨水流量:评估墨水流量是否平稳,不间断或溢出。

笔尖尺寸:测量笔尖尺寸以确保其符合预期厚度和宽度。

性能测试

耐久性:通过跌落、扭曲和压力测试,评估笔的整体耐用性。

书写距离:测量笔的墨水容量,以确定其书写距离和持续使用时间。

干燥时间:验证墨水在纸张上干燥所需的时间。

用户体验测试

握持舒适度:评估笔的握持是否舒适,不引起手部疲劳或疼痛。

携带便利性:测试笔是否便于携带,例如是否有夹子或笔帽。

美学吸引力:评估笔的外观和设计是否符合目标受众的审美偏好。

结论

通过进行全面的软件测试,你可以深入了解一支笔的各个方面,包括其功能、性能和用户体验。这些见解可用于改进产品质量、识别缺陷并为消费者提供有价值的信息。

软件测试怎么测试的

软件测试——如何进行?

标签: 软件测试、测试方法、测试类型

软件测试是评估软件产品和服务是否符合预期的行为和标准的过程。它对于确保软件的质量、可靠性和可维护性至关重要。了解软件测试的各种方法和类型对于有效执行测试至关重要。

功能测试

标签: 功能测试、黑盒测试

功能测试涉及根据软件的规格文档评估其预期行为。它关注软件对用户的可见功能,而无需了解其内部实现。功能测试通常使用黑盒测试技术,这意味着测试人员不考虑软件的内部代码。

单元测试

标签: 单元测试、白盒测试

单元测试是针对软件的个别单元或模块进行的。它涉及检查每个单元的行为是否符合预期。单元测试通常使用白盒测试技术,这意味着测试人员可以访问软件的源代码。

集成测试

标签: 集成测试、协作测试

集成测试涉及测试多个软件组件或模块如何协同工作。它有助于发现组件之间的接口问题和依赖性问题。集成测试通常需要多个团队之间的协作,包括开发人员和测试人员。

系统测试

标签: 系统测试、端到端测试

系统测试评估软件的整体行为,包括所有集成组件和外部依赖项。它通常使用端到端测试方法,从头到尾执行完整的业务流程。系统测试有助于发现与软件整体架构和性能相关的问题。

回归测试

标签: 回归测试、变更验证

回归测试是对先前测试过的软件进行的,以验证其在更改或更新后仍能正常工作。它有助于确保软件变更不会引入新的缺陷或回归旧的缺陷。

性能测试

标签: 性能测试、负载测试

性能测试评估软件在不同负载和压力条件下的性能。它可以帮助确定系统的瓶颈、响应时间和容量限制。性能测试通常涉及使用负载测试工具来模拟大量用户或请求。

软件测试怎么测试一个杯子

软件测试如何测试一个杯子

标签: 软件测试,杯子测试,质量保证

测试需求分析

测试杯子的目的是确保其满足特定需求,例如容量、耐用性、可洗性和美观。测试团队应与利益相关者合作,确定关键的测试需求。

测试用例设计

基于测试需求,测试团队设计测试用例来覆盖各种场景。这些用例可能包括:

容量测试:检查杯子是否能容纳预期的液体量。

耐用性测试:将杯子暴露在不同的力、冲击和温度下,以评估其抗损坏能力。

可洗性测试:重复多次清洗循环,以检查杯子是否仍能保持其形状和颜色。

美观测试:评估杯子的外观、造型和颜色是否符合预期标准。

测试执行

测试团队按照测试用例进行实际测试。测试可能涉及使用自动化工具、手工测试和外部实验室。测试结果通过比较实际结果与预期结果来记录和分析。

缺陷报告和跟踪

如果在测试过程中发现缺陷,则将创建缺陷报告并分配给相关团队进行解决。缺陷跟踪系统用于管理和监控缺陷解决进度,并确保所有缺陷得到及时解决。

结论

通过遵循严格的测试方法,软件测试可以确保杯子满足预期的质量和性能标准。通过验证其容量、耐用性、可洗性和美观,测试团队有助于确保客户收到符合其期望和目的的产品。 (随机推荐阅读本站500篇优秀文章点击前往:500篇优秀随机文章)

来源:本文由易搜IT博客原创撰写,欢迎分享本文,转载请保留出处和链接!